An established and well-regarded organisation is seeking a Network Engineer to join its IT Systems team. This is a technical role with responsibility for the ongoing development, resilience and security of a complex, multi-site network environment supporting critical organisation-wide services.

Working closely with the IT Systems Manager, you will take ownership of day-to-day network operations while contributing to the design, evolution and long-term strategy of the network and communications architecture.

The Role

You will be responsible for the management, maintenance and optimisation of the organisation's network and communication systems, ensuring performance, availability and security across all sites. Key responsibilities include:

  • Managing LAN and WAN infrastructure, including switches, VLANs and routing
  • Supporting enterprise wireless networks, VPNs and remote access solutions
  • Administering firewalls, network security controls and access management
  • Supporting Microsoft network services including DNS and DHCP
  • Managing telephony and unified communications platforms
  • Proactive monitoring, fault diagnosis, traffic analysis and capacity planning
  • Delivering network projects, upgrades and new technology implementations
  • Working with suppliers and contractors to maintain service quality
  • Supporting incident, problem and change management in line with ITIL best practice
  • Providing technical guidance, mentoring and supervision to network staff

The role may involve occasional out-of-hours support and hands-on work in comms rooms or building environments.

Criteria

  • Experience of data networking within a multi-site IT service environment
  • Advanced knowledge of Ethernet switching and routing protocols
  • Detailed knowledge of network security equipment and system maintenance
  • Proven experience in fault identification, troubleshooting and resolution
  • Strong knowledge of Cisco and/or HP networking technologies and Microsoft network services
  • Detailed understanding of low-level network protocols and how they support higher-level services
  • Strong experience supporting wireless network infrastructure and associated systems

How to prepare for a job interview at VANRATH

Know Your Networking Basics

Brush up on your knowledge of Ethernet switching, routing protocols, and network security. Be ready to discuss how these concepts apply to real-world scenarios, especially in a multi-site environment. This will show that you understand the technical requirements of the role.

Showcase Your Problem-Solving Skills

Prepare examples of past experiences where you identified and resolved network issues.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ers. This will demonstrate your troubleshooting abilities and how you can contribute to maintaining network resilience.

Familiarise Yourself with ITIL Practices

Since the role involves incident, problem, and change management, it’s crucial to understand ITIL best practices. Be prepared to discuss how you've applied these principles in previous roles or how you would approach them in this position.

Ask Insightful Questions

At the end of the interview, ask questions that show your interest in the company’s network strategy and future projects. Inquire about their current challenges or upcoming technologies they plan to implement. This not only shows your enthusiasm but also helps you gauge if the company is the right fit for you.
